(1) The IBAC may give advice to the public sector on any matter included in a guideline issued by the IBAC under this Part.
(2) The giving of advice by the IBAC under subsection (1) does not give rise to—
(a) any right, expectation, duty or obligation that would not otherwise be conferred or imposed on the person to whom the advice is given; or
(b) any defence that would not otherwise be available to that person.
(3) Without limiting subsection (2)(b), the giving of advice by the IBAC under subsection (1) does not give rise to a defence to proceedings for an offence under section 45(1).
